Not quite. Max Drift = Windspeed in Knots/TAS in nm per minute. E.g. - 15 kt of wind, TAS 90 kts, Max Drift = 15/(3/2) = 10 deg.
Angular factor is the same as on your wristwatch. 30 off is 1/2, 15 off is 1/4, 60 or more - use all of max drift.
That's the basic drift sorted. Apply 3 times the assessed drift outbound in the hold (up to a max of 45 deg) and the basic drift inbound.....
But there is NO REQUIREMENT to fly a hold on an IMC revalidation unless ATC so direct.
